Application Specialist Lead (Finance)
This role involves coordinating with providing guidance and direction to Application Specialists, coordinating with managers, and managing escalations issues related to applicants.
Responsibilities include, but are not limited to:
o Lead a small team of Application Specialist who review applications to ensure the information is complete and the applicant has provided all required documentation.
o Set expectations and production goals for the team.
o Set a work schedule to accommodate work load and staff availability.
o Follow standard operating procedures, training materials, checklists, and other job aids to oversee application processing.
o Ensure staff are Communicating effectively and efficiently with program applicants to provide status on their application, answer questions related to the program, and collect documentation from program applicants to complete their application.
o Communicate with staff in multiple formats including face-to-face team meetings, and via telephone, text, and email communication.
o Ensure staff are accurately documenting relevant notes of interactions with program applicants to progress their application.
o Ensure team is achieving daily processing expectations and documenting activities to demonstrate productivity.
o Maintain adherence to program standard operating procedures and the program health and safety plan.
o Communicate with supervisors for directives, work schedule, program changes, and other relevant information via email, telephone, text, and Microsoft Teams.
o Escalate issues following standard operating procedures.
o Use Microsoft Office applications and other software to document time worked, activities completed, applicant information, and applicant interactions.
o Review Application Specialist time and productivity reporting to ensure accuracy and efficiency.
Qualifications:
o Bachelor's degree in Communications, Public Administration, Emergency Management, or a related field required.
o At least 3 years of experience in community assistance, disaster recovery, case management, or social services.
o Strong communication, organizational, and interpersonal skills; ability to work empathetically with diverse populations.
The ideal candidate will preferably have:
o Previous experience in managing a team to process applications and conduct eligibility review.
o Flexible availability to accommodate community needs, including evenings and weekends.
Standard Schedule:
o This is a temporary assignment expected to last 6 months.
o Work hours are 8 hours per day 5 days per week. 30 minute Lunch & 2 Fifteen Minute Breaks. This may change based on program needs.
